The Future of Data Encryption

Data encryption is a cornerstone of information security, ensuring that sensitive data remains confidential and protected from unauthorized access. As we approach 2024, several trends are emerging that will shape the future of data encryption and overall cybersecurity.

1. Enhanced Encryption Algorithms

With the increasing sophistication of cyber threats, traditional encryption methods are becoming less effective. Researchers are developing enhanced encryption algorithms that offer stronger security features, allowing organizations to better protect their data against potential breaches.

2. Quantum Encryption on the Horizon

Quantum computing poses a significant threat to current encryption methods. However, advancements in quantum encryption technology are emerging as a potential solution. This groundbreaking technology utilizes the principles of quantum mechanics to create encryption that could be virtually unbreakable.

3. Encryption as a Service (EaaS)

As businesses increasingly migrate to cloud services, Encryption as a Service (EaaS) is gaining traction. This model allows organizations to implement encryption solutions without the need for extensive in-house expertise, enhancing data security while streamlining operations.

4. End-to-End Encryption for All

End-to-end encryption (E2EE) is becoming a standard practice for various communications and data-sharing applications. This method ensures that only the sender and recipient can access the information, further safeguarding privacy and security.

5. Regulation and Compliance

As awareness of data privacy grows, regulatory frameworks surrounding data encryption are becoming more stringent. Organizations must stay compliant with laws that mandate encryption for sensitive data, prompting a shift towards more robust encryption practices.

Conclusion

The future of data encryption is poised for significant advancements as technology evolves and cyber threats become more complex. By staying informed about emerging trends and adopting innovative encryption methods, organizations can effectively secure their data and uphold their commitment to privacy and protection.
